The HR Business Partner (HRBP) works closely with the company’s managers to develop HR agenda that will support the overall goals of the company. He/she coordinates with the management to put in place the policies and practices of the employees of the company that are aligned to the operational needs of the business.

WHAT ARE THE RE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S OF AN HR BUSINESS PARTNER?

  • Must have at least 2 years experience as an HR Practitioner – HR Specialist, HR Generalist, HR Officer, Team Leader, Supervisory, or Assistant Manager.
  • Holds a degree in Human Resources, Psychology, or any related field or equivalent knowledge and understanding.
  • Must have exposure to Human Resources Management, Hiring, Developing Standards, Foster Teamwork, Management Proficiency, Managing Profitability, Promoting Process Improvement, Building Relationships, People Skills, and Retaining Employees.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ills including the ability to communicate with employees and suppliers at all levels.
  • Proactive, Proficiency with employee relations, people champions, Excellent stakeholder management, and developing good work relationships across the organization
  • Demonstrated ability with training and development programs. Good change management and project management capabilities
  • Knowledgeable in any HRIS
  • Knowledgeable in MS and Google Office.
